SubjectRe: [PATCH v2 10/17] leds: leds-nuc: Add support to blink behavior for NUC8/10
Em Wed, 19 May 2021 09:58:50 +0200
Marek Behun <marek.behun@nic.cz> escreveu:

> This should be implemented via the blink trigger or hw_pattern, I think.
> Have you looked at these?

The blink trigger and hw_pattern are software implementations for blink.

This is not the case on NUC leds, as:

1. It is the hardware/firmware that triggers the blink, not Linux;
2. It blinks even when Linux in suspend/hibernate mode.

In a matter of fact, the default usage of blink is to indicate that the
machine is suspended.
